For a while now I have been having a problem with my clutch system.  The deal is, when I stomp the pedal, I get good pressure and everything is kosher.  The issue is that if I push the pedal slowly, it goes right to the floor with no pressure at all.

 

Bad master or slave or just still air in the line?  What do you think?

Link to comment

Bad slave...there would be a leak...

 

Probably the master.....it's by-passing the seal inside when you press slowly...

 

.....when you romp on it.....the fluid doesn't have enough time to seep past the seal....

 

Air in the lines would cause a spongy pedal...possibly real low clutch engagement....

 

 

 

 

It's gotta be the M/C.....not much to the system.....

Clutch master cylinder R&R done!  Such a good feeling when pressure returns to the pedal :)  Bleeding was a bitch, it took me a few days to find the right technique.  Success was had by holding the pedal to the floor, open the bleeder, push the slave back in by hand then close bleeder and repeat.  The final step was to adjust the pedal for free-play and BAM! we have clutch :w00t: .
